Foros del Web » Soporte técnico » Ofimática »

Macro para Ceros adelante

Estas en el tema de Macro para Ceros adelante en el foro de Ofimática en Foros del Web. Dejo libro con el codigo 'http://www.4shared.com/get/d5-RVFjP/Aleatorios_no_repetidos_2_.html La exposicion está escrita en la hoja El caso es para que al presionar el buton, SIEMPRE mantenga 3 ...
  #1 (permalink)  
Antiguo 16/03/2012, 14:34
 
Fecha de Ingreso: agosto-2007
Mensajes: 1.945
Antigüedad: 17 años, 3 meses
Puntos: 39
Macro para Ceros adelante

Dejo libro con el codigo
'http://www.4shared.com/get/d5-RVFjP/Aleatorios_no_repetidos_2_.html

La exposicion está escrita en la hoja

El caso es para que al presionar el buton, SIEMPRE mantenga 3 caracteres numericos.
Si aparece 1 solo caracter(numerico) que sea se coloquen 2 ceros adelante y si un numero de 2 caracteres, que se coloque 1 cero adelante
EJ: 5 (005), 18 (018).
__________________
Las contraseñas son como la ropa interior: Nunca dejarlas donde la gente pueda verlas
http://i64.tinypic.com/rho40i.jpg
  #2 (permalink)  
Antiguo 16/03/2012, 17:04
Avatar de mrocf  
Fecha de Ingreso: marzo-2007
Ubicación: Bs.As.
Mensajes: 1.103
Antigüedad: 17 años, 8 meses
Puntos: 88
Respuesta: Macro para Ceros adelante

Reconozco que tu descripción no me quedó -para nada- clara.

Sin embargo quizás te pueda orientar saber que:

En Excel:
Para que una celda tenga el formato que mencionas, no se requiere que esté con formato texto, sino con el formato personalizado: "000"

En VBA:
Range("D1") = 45
Esto asigna a la celda D1 el valor 045 si la celda tiene el formato antes mencionado.

Saludos, Cacho R.
  #3 (permalink)  
Antiguo 16/03/2012, 19:59
 
Fecha de Ingreso: agosto-2007
Mensajes: 1.945
Antigüedad: 17 años, 3 meses
Puntos: 39
Respuesta: Macro para Ceros adelante

De acuerdo sobre el formato de celdas.

Hice tu recomendacion y resulto para las celdas lo cual agradezco pero, ¿para los TextBox del formulario?
__________________
Las contraseñas son como la ropa interior: Nunca dejarlas donde la gente pueda verlas
http://i64.tinypic.com/rho40i.jpg

Última edición por JoaoM; 16/03/2012 a las 20:05

Etiquetas: excel
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 22:30.